St Eugene Golf Resort & Casino Summary

This golf and casino resort is located 10 minutes from Cranbrook, British Columbia, and 20 minutes from the picturesque town of Kimberley. It is framed by the Canadian Rockies, the Purcell Mountains and the St. Mary's river. It is also just minutes from the Fort Steele heritage town and the Canadian Museum of Rail Travel. Cranbrook/Canadian Rockies International Airport is 5 minutes away. Steeped in tradition, this original resort and casino is an impressive turn-of-the-century stone building. The resort is the only project in Canada where a First Nation decided to turn an icon of an often sad period of its history into a powerful economic engine by converting an old Indian residential school into an international resort destination. It offers 125 rooms, including 49 single rooms, 73 double/twin rooms, 1 junior suite and 2 suites. Air conditioning, a lobby, 24-hour reception and check-out, a hotel safe, lift access, a pub and a number of restaurants are provided. 372 m² of meeting space and the 1767 m² Casino of the Rockies also feature. Room service is available for a fee, and free unlimited parking is available to guests arriving by car. A complimentary airport shuttle service is provided. There is also a shuttle service offering frequent daily trips from the Casino of the Rockies to Cranbrook (complimentary). The beautifully appointed guest rooms offer a warm and inviting atmosphere and feature heritage 1900s' décor. The turn-of-the-century furnishings, together with all the added touches, offer guests the opportunity to immerse themselves in the beauty of their surroundings. Each room comes with either 1 king-size bed or 2 double beds. The following amenities are included in all standard rooms: complimentary tea and coffee making facilities, an ironing board, hairdryer, satellite/cable TV, safe, mini fridge and high-speed Internet access. An en suite bathroom with bath and shower, as well as individually regulated air conditioning and heating, also features.

You’ll find Kimberley in the Purcell mountains of British Columbia and while the resort is little known, it packs a pretty big punch. Because it’s not as big a name as massive BC resorts like Whistler, the area’s known for being gloriously crowd free, letting you roam the ski area without hanging around in queues or having to worry about traffic on the piste. The massive ski area includes 4 sections: Northstar mountain, Tamarack Ridge, Vimy Ridge and Black Forest with 68 marked runs and 12 in the glades. The new Owl zone is super for learning the basics if you’re skiing for the first time. Beginners and early intermediates should start off on Northstar mountain. Easy Way and Canada Way will get beginners started while more confident skiers can try Midwinter and Ego Alley. In the resort, Montana’s has a super menu, cosy fireplaces and super views of the mountains. Stemwinder Bar & Grill is the place to be for après, with a good sized bar, BBQ, music and entertainment. You’ll also find an outdoor Ice Rink, usually with a nearby bonfire to keep non-skaters warm. Other activities include bowling and curling and you can watch the latest blockbusters in the cinema (in previous years there’s been a shuttle bus to take you to the cinema and back).
